Celebrate the Queen of Crime on the English Riviera! Each September, Torquay and the wider Bay come alive with the International Agatha Christie Festival, a week-long celebration of literature, mystery, culture and community set in Agatha Christie’s birthplace. From inspiring talks and guided walks to murder mystery fun and family-friendly events, there’s something for every guest to enjoy.
Event Details
- Dates: Saturday 12th – Sunday 20th September 2026
- Main venues: Torre Abbey Historic House & Gardens, Spanish Barn and various locations across Torquay, Paignton & Brixham – English Riviera, Devon
- Tickets: Available via the official festival website (programmes and booking usually go live in spring)
What to Expect
Expect a rich and varied festival filled with:
- Literary talks & author panels celebrating Agatha Christie’s life, works and legacy.
- Guided walks including the famed Agatha Christie Mile exploring key locations linked to her life.
- Workshops & creative sessions for crime writers and fans alike.
- Film screenings, theatre performances and immersive experiences inspired by Christie’s stories.
- Family activities such as storytelling, children’s events and mystery challenges.
- Vintage fairs, garden parties & social events, including afternoon teas and celebrations of Christie’s 125th anniversary.
- Book tents, signings & merchandise celebrating Christie’s global impact.
Free daily readings and mini-events often take place in Torre Abbey Gardens, while many ticketed talks and performances are held in the historic Spanish Barn or at venues across the Bay.

Travelling around the English Riviera during the Festival is simple, with several convenient options available:
Car – Torquay and surrounding towns offer public car parks close to Festival venues.
Train – Torquay station is just a short walk from Torre Abbey and other central locations.
Bus – Regular services connect Torquay, Paignton and Brixham throughout the day.
Boat – Enjoy a scenic ferry journey across the Bay between Torquay, Paignton and Brixham for a truly memorable arrival.
